- Gas Safe -What is Gas safe? The Gas Safe Register replaced the Corgi Gas Register in Great Britain and the Isle of Man on 1st April 2009 www.gassaferegister.co.uk.
Look for the yellow Gas Safe Register triangle not the orange CORGI registration badge. Anyone carrying out work on gas must be registered with Gas Safe Register. If not, they are breaking the law and putting you and your family at risk.
Only a Gas Safe registered engineer is legally allowed to install gas appliances, boilers, hobs, ovens or fires in your home or workplace. You must only use a Gas Safe registered engineer for any type of gas work, including installation, maintenance and servicing.
- HETAS - What is HETAS? HETAS is the official body recognised by government to approve solid fuel domestic heating appliances, fuels and services. Its work in Approving products covers boilers, cookers, open fires and stoves and room heaters. It also lists in its Official Guide, factory made chimneys and carbon monoxide detectors and alarms suitable for use with solid fuel. www.hetas.co.uk
